A Combined Optimization-Theoretic and Side- Channel Approach for Attacking Strong Physical Unclonable Functions. |
Abstract | ||
---|---|---|
The promise of strong physical unclonable functions (PUF) is to utilize the manufacturing variations of circuit elements to produce an independent and unpredictable response to any input challenge vector. Attacks on PUFs that predict the responses to input challenge vectors offer an interesting research problem.
